WebFeb 8, 2024 · For brewing, you need to crush the endosperm into a few large pieces without so much as tearing the husk, and without making any flour. Rollers are the tool for this job. For flour, everything must be broken down as finely as possible, and the best tool for this is a hammer mill, or a very specifically designed burr mill.

Brewer's spent grain ( BSG) or draff is a food waste that is a byproduct of the brewing industry that makes up 85 percent [1] of brewing waste. WebAug 10, 2015 · 1) Turning it into Baked Goods. Several companies use brewers’ spent grains for bread, granola bars, and even dog treats.
